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
240164753 50162279 6390 50124626194
2127137619 81
2127137619 81
19480 64 2724 3168 411759973
All about undefined
Interested in learning more?
2127137619 81
19480 64 2724 3168 411759973
See more
3139225344 005
4208535091 3148 5688937 2976 4264
See more
5568 75932348 73862
7379865 436716 1736
See more